Plain-English summary
Biomet Microfixation, LLC is recalling one unit of the Biomet Microfixation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Patient Matched Left Fossa, Part #CP751506, Lot #478490. The recall was initiated because a product mix-up occurred prior to the final package and labeling process.
The affected product is a component of the Total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) replacement system, which is implanted in the jaw to reconstruct a diseased or damaged temporomandibular joint. The specific unit involved in this recall was distributed to Denmark only.
Consumers and healthcare providers who have this specific part number and lot number should contact Biomet Microfixation, LLC for further instructions. The source text does not report any illnesses or injuries associated with this recall.
